The iPhone 12 Pro Max, released in late 2020, and the iPhone 15 Plus, launched in late 2023, represent different generations of Apple's large-screen smartphone offerings. While both provide a premium iOS experience, the iPhone 15 Plus introduces a more advanced internal architecture, an updated camera system, and modern features like the Dynamic Island and a USB-C port, setting it apart from its predecessor.

Durability

The practical lifespan of these devices is largely influenced by their release dates and subsequent software support.

  • Software Longevity: The iPhone 12 Pro Max, released in 2020, is expected to receive major iOS updates until approximately late 2025 or early 2026. The iPhone 15 Plus, being a 2023 model, will benefit from several additional years of software support, likely extending to late 2028 or early 2029.
  • Physical Durability: Both models feature Ceramic Shield front covers and IP68 water and dust resistance, offering robust protection against everyday hazards. The iPhone 15 Plus incorporates a color-infused glass back and an aerospace-grade aluminum frame, which contributes to a lighter feel compared to the 12 Pro Max's stainless steel frame.
  • Repairability: Both devices offer a similar level of repairability within the iPhone ecosystem, with common components being serviceable by trained technicians.

Performance

Performance differences are notable due to the generational gap in their internal processing capabilities.

  • Processing Power: The iPhone 12 Pro Max handles everyday applications and multitasking smoothly, but its older-generation processor may show limitations with the most demanding games or future intensive applications. The iPhone 15 Plus features a significantly more powerful and efficient processor, ensuring seamless performance for current and upcoming high-demand tasks, advanced gaming, and complex photo/video editing.
  • System Responsiveness: Users will experience a snappier and more fluid interface on the iPhone 15 Plus, with faster app loading times and smoother transitions. The 12 Pro Max remains responsive for general use but may exhibit slight delays in comparison.
  • Battery Behavior: The iPhone 15 Plus offers substantially improved battery life, often lasting through a full day of heavy use and beyond, thanks to its larger battery capacity and more power-efficient components. The iPhone 12 Pro Max provides good battery life for its age, typically lasting a full day with moderate usage, though heavy users may find themselves needing to recharge sooner.

Screen quality

Both devices offer large, high-quality displays, but the iPhone 15 Plus introduces some key advancements.

  • Display Technology: Both phones feature a 6.7-inch Super Retina XDR OLED display, providing deep blacks, vibrant colors, and excellent contrast.
  • Brightness and Clarity: The iPhone 15 Plus offers higher peak brightness, making content more visible and enjoyable in bright outdoor conditions. Both displays deliver sharp text and clear images with similar pixel density.
  • User Interface: A significant difference is the iPhone 15 Plus's Dynamic Island, which replaces the traditional notch found on the iPhone 12 Pro Max. The Dynamic Island integrates alerts and background activities into an interactive, pill-shaped cutout. Both models feature a standard 60Hz refresh rate.

Audiovisual

The camera systems on these two models reflect significant advancements over three generations.

  • Main Camera System: The iPhone 12 Pro Max features a versatile triple 12-megapixel camera system, including a wide, ultra-wide, and a 2.5x optical telephoto lens, alongside a LiDAR scanner for improved low-light focusing and AR. The iPhone 15 Plus upgrades to a 48-megapixel main camera sensor, which captures significantly more detail and performs better in challenging lighting conditions, alongside a 12-megapixel ultra-wide lens. It also offers a 2x optical quality telephoto option by cropping from the high-resolution main sensor.
  • Photography Performance: The 15 Plus excels in capturing finer details and offers improved low-light performance, particularly with its larger main sensor. Both are capable of excellent everyday photography, but the 15 Plus benefits from more advanced computational photography.
  • Video and Audio: Both devices record high-quality video, with the iPhone 15 Plus offering enhanced stabilization and cinematic mode capabilities. Audio recording and speaker output are robust on both, with the 15 Plus potentially offering minor refinements in clarity and bass response.

Miscellaneous

Beyond core features, several practical elements differentiate these two iPhones.

  • Connectivity: The iPhone 15 Plus supports newer Wi-Fi standards and potentially a more advanced 5G modem, offering faster and more reliable wireless connections compared to the iPhone 12 Pro Max. Both support Face ID for secure authentication.
  • Charging Port: A major practical distinction is the charging port. The iPhone 12 Pro Max uses Apple's proprietary Lightning port, while the iPhone 15 Plus adopts the more universal USB-C standard, allowing for broader compatibility with accessories and chargers.
  • Design and Handling: The iPhone 12 Pro Max features a stainless steel frame, giving it a premium but heavier feel. The iPhone 15 Plus, with its aerospace-grade aluminum frame and contoured edges, is noticeably lighter and may offer a more comfortable grip for some users, despite both having a 6.7-inch screen.

Choosing between the iPhone 12 Pro Max and the iPhone 15 Plus involves weighing modern advancements against established performance. Users frequently praise the iPhone 12 Pro Max for its robust build, still-capable camera system, and large display, making it a solid choice for those who value a premium feel and a large screen without needing the absolute latest features. However, some users note its weight and the impending end of its software update cycle as potential drawbacks.

The iPhone 15 Plus is often lauded for its significantly improved battery life, the versatile 48-megapixel main camera, the interactive Dynamic Island, and the convenience of the USB-C port. Its extended software support and lighter design are also frequently highlighted as benefits. Criticisms are less common but sometimes point to the lack of a ProMotion display or a dedicated telephoto lens compared to its 'Pro' counterparts.

Users prioritizing long-term software support, superior battery endurance, a more advanced camera, and the modern USB-C standard will find the iPhone 15 Plus well-suited to their needs. Conversely, those seeking a large-screen iPhone for everyday tasks, who are less concerned with the latest features and software longevity, may find the iPhone 12 Pro Max to be a capable option.
